What Are Solar Nails, Bio Gel & UV Gel?
When comparing solar nails vs gel nails, the first thing to understand is that “gel nails” covers two very different products: bio gel and UV gel. Each behaves differently, lasts differently, and suits different nail types and lifestyles. Solar nails, meanwhile, are not gel at all — they are an acrylic-based system.
Here is a clear definition of each type before we dive into the comparisons:
Solar Nails (Solar Gel)
A UV-stabilized acrylic nail system originally developed by Creative Nail Design (CND). Applied using a brush-and-bead acrylic technique, solar nails air-cure through polymerization — no UV or LED lamp required. Often called “solar gel nails” colloquially, though they are technically an acrylic product. Known for their UV-resistance, exceptional durability, and built-in French manicure finish.
Bio Gel Nails
A flexible, rubber-like gel system that cures under UV or LED light. Bio gel (sometimes called “builder gel” or “biogel”) contains a breathable polymer formula that flexes with the natural nail, reducing the risk of cracking and lifting. It bonds directly to the natural nail without primers, making it gentler on nail health than acrylic systems. Popular in Canada, Australia, and the UK.
UV Gel Nails
A hard, shiny gel nail system cured under UV or LED light. Traditional UV gel nails create a glossy, glass-like finish and feel lighter and more natural than acrylics. They include gel polish (shellac), hard gel extensions, and soft gel systems. UV gel is the most common nail enhancement type globally, prized for its high shine and comfort, though slightly less durable than solar or bio gel.
Many salons use “gel nails” and “solar nails” interchangeably, which causes significant confusion. When a client asks for “solar gel nails,” a technician may apply bio gel, UV gel, or actual solar (acrylic) nails — three entirely different products with different properties, costs, and maintenance schedules. Knowing the distinction helps you get exactly what you want and pay the right price.

UV Gel vs Solar Gel Nails — Key Differences
While bio gel is the premium flexible alternative, UV gel nails (the classic hard gel or gel polish system) is what most people think of when they say “gel nails.” Here is how UV gel compares to solar nails specifically:
| Factor | ☀️ Solar Nails | 💜 UV Gel Nails |
|---|---|---|
| Curing method | Air oxidation — no lamp ✦ | UV or LED lamp required |
| Durability | 3–5 weeks ✦ | 2–3 weeks (gel polish) 3–4 weeks (hard gel) |
| UV resistance (yellowing) | Excellent — UV-stabilized ✦ | Moderate — may yellow with sun exposure |
| Feel on nail | Rigid, heavier | Lightweight, natural feel ✦ |
| Color variety | Classic pink-white + polish over top | Hundreds of gel polish colors ✦ |
| Odour during application | Strong chemical monomer smell | Low odor ✦ |
| Removal ease | Medium — foil wrap 15–25 min | Easy — soak 10–15 min ✦ |
| Cost (full set) | $45–$70 (USA) | $35–$65 (USA) — slightly cheaper ✦ |
| Best for | Active lifestyles, French look, long wear ✦ | Color variety, natural feel, budget-friendly |
If you frequently spend time outdoors, swim, or need nails that hold up under physical work, solar nails win on durability and UV resistance. If you love changing your color frequently, want a lighter feel, or work in environments where strong chemical odors are not appropriate, UV gel nails are the better fit.

Solar Nails: Pros & Cons
Before choosing solar nails over gel, here is a balanced view of everything they offer — and every limitation to be aware of:
| ✅ Pros of Solar Nails | ❌ Cons of Solar Nails |
|---|---|
| No UV lamp required. Cures through air oxidation — zero equipment investment for the client and faster setup at the salon. | Strong chemical odor. Liquid monomer has a powerful smell that some clients and pregnant women cannot tolerate. Requires good salon ventilation. |
| Exceptional durability (3–5 weeks). Outperforms all gel types in longevity — ideal for those who want maximum time between salon appointments. | Rigid feel. The acrylic structure is stiffer than bio or UV gel. Active nail bending (typing, musical instruments) takes adjustment. |
| UV and yellowing resistant. The formula maintains its color under sun exposure, swimming, and tanning — something standard acrylics and UV gel cannot match. | Longer removal process. Requires filing then 15–25 minutes of acetone soaking. Cannot simply peel or pop off safely. |
| Built-in French manicure. The classic pink-and-white acrylic application delivers a permanent French look without polish that chips or fades. | Less breathable than bio gel. The solid acrylic layer provides less oxygen exchange with the natural nail, which can contribute to dehydration over many consecutive sets. |
| Fill-only maintenance. Only the new nail growth needs addressing every 3–4 weeks — no full removal required for months, reducing acetone exposure overall. | Not suitable for severely damaged nails. Existing fungal infections, trauma, or extreme thinning must be resolved before application. |
| Superior strength vs gel. Chip and crack resistant even under physical stress, making solar nails ideal for tradespeople, nurses, gardeners, and athletes. | Higher upfront cost. Full sets start at $45–$70 in the USA and CA$55–$85 in Canada — more expensive than standard gel polish or UV gel manicures. |
Gel Nails (Bio Gel & UV Gel): Pros & Cons
Gel nails come in two main forms — bio gel and UV gel — and each has its own distinct strengths and weaknesses relative to solar nails:
🌿 Bio Gel Pros & Cons
| ✅ Pros of Bio Gel | ❌ Cons of Bio Gel |
|---|---|
| Genuinely breathable. Bio gel’s porous polymer structure allows some oxygen exchange with the natural nail — the most breathable enhancement option available. | Requires UV/LED lamp. Cannot air-cure; a professional lamp is mandatory for every coat applied. |
| Flexible and impact-absorbing. Bends with the natural nail rather than snapping — ideal for people who tend to break standard acrylics. | Can lift under pressure. The flexibility that makes bio gel comfortable also means heavy-handed use or excessive moisture can cause lifting at the cuticle edge. |
| Gentler on natural nails. No aggressive primer; minimal filing prep. Most compatible with fragile or damaged natural nails. | Higher price point. Bio gel is a specialty product and requires specific training; fewer salons offer it, which drives up cost ($50–$80 full set). |
| Low odor. No liquid monomer means no strong chemical smell — suitable for clients sensitive to fumes or working in scent-restricted environments. | Less widely available. Not every nail salon stocks bio gel or has trained technicians. Common in Canada and Australia; less so in the USA. |
💜 UV Gel Pros & Cons
| ✅ Pros of UV Gel | ❌ Cons of UV Gel |
|---|---|
| Extremely glossy finish. UV gel creates the highest-shine, most mirror-like finish of any nail system — prized for its polished appearance. | Shorter lifespan (2–3 weeks). Standard UV gel polish begins to chip and lose luster faster than solar or bio gel. |
| Hundreds of color options. The gel polish market offers thousands of shades and finishes — far more variety than the built-in tones of solar acrylic. | UV lamp exposure. Repeated UV lamp use raises minor cumulative skin exposure concerns (though modern LED lamps reduce this significantly). |
| Lightweight and comfortable. UV gel is significantly thinner and lighter than solar acrylic — many clients prefer the natural, barely-there feel. | Can yellow outdoors. Without the UV-stabilizing formula of solar nails, UV gel may discolor with prolonged sun exposure, especially in lighter shades. |
| Most affordable gel option. Gel polish full sets start at $35–$65 in the USA — typically the most budget-friendly salon enhancement option. | More frequent appointments. 2–3 week lifespan means more visits per year than solar or bio gel — the long-term cost can equalize or exceed solar. |

Tips for Protecting Natural Nails Under Any Enhancement
- Schedule fills every 3–4 weeks — overgrown enhancements create stress fractures at the nail bond.
- Apply cuticle oil twice daily to keep the nail bed hydrated under any enhancement.
- Give natural nails a 2–4 week rest between full removal and new sets — especially after 6+ months of continuous wear.
- Never forcibly peel or rip off any enhancement type — this strips surface nail layers and causes lasting thinning.
- Wear rubber gloves when cleaning with bleach, harsh detergents, or acetone-based products.
- Tell your technician immediately if you notice lifting — trapped moisture under any enhancement risks bacterial or fungal growth.

How to Remove Solar Gel, Bio Gel & UV Gel Nails
Removal method is one of the most practically important differences between nail types. Here is how each system comes off:
Solar / Solar Gel Removal
File the shiny top surface to break the seal, then soak in 100% acetone-soaked cotton wrapped in foil for 15–25 minutes. Gently push off softened acrylic with a cuticle pusher. Buff smooth and hydrate. Time: 30–45 minutes.
Bio Gel Removal
Soak in acetone for 10–15 minutes (or use foil wraps). Many bio gel brands partially peel away in sections after soaking. Gently push off, buff lightly, and apply cuticle oil. Time: 20–30 minutes. Some formulations can be filed off without acetone.
UV Gel / Gel Polish Removal
Lightly file off the shiny top coat, then soak in acetone for 10–15 minutes using foil wraps or a bowl soak. Gel polish slides off easily in sheets. Time: 20–25 minutes. Soft gels can be removed with minimal acetone.
Step-by-Step: Removing Solar Gel Nails at Home
- 1File the top surface
Use a coarse 80-grit file to dull the entire surface of each nail. You do not need to file through the acrylic — just break the shiny seal so acetone can penetrate. This step reduces soak time by 30–40%.
- 2Protect surrounding skin
Apply petroleum jelly or thick cuticle oil around (not on) each nail to protect the skin from drying out during acetone exposure.
- 3Soak cotton in 100% acetone and wrap
Saturate a cotton ball with pure acetone, press it against the nail surface, and wrap tightly with a small square of aluminum foil. Repeat for all ten fingers to prevent acetone evaporation.
- 4Wait 15–25 minutes
Leave wraps in place until the acrylic feels soft and gummy. For older or thicker sets, allow the full 25 minutes. Never rush this stage — under-soaked acrylic will not release cleanly.
- 5Gently push off softened acrylic
Remove one wrap at a time and slide the softened acrylic off using a cuticle pusher. Apply light, sweeping pressure only — never scrape hard. Rewrap any resistant nails for 5 more minutes.
- 6Buff smooth and nourish
Use a 220-grit buffer to lightly smooth the natural nail surface. Apply generous cuticle oil and a thick hand cream. Your nails will feel temporarily soft — avoid picking or biting for 24 hours while they re-harden.
Forcibly peeling solar nails, bio gel, or UV gel strips the top layers of your natural nail, causing lasting thinning, sensitivity, and surface damage. Patience with the acetone process always protects your nail health long-term.

Yes — some technicians offer hybrid services. For example, a solar (acrylic) overlay for strength and structure, finished with UV gel polish for a wider range of colors and high shine. This combination gives you the durability of solar with the color flexibility of gel polish. Ask your nail technician if they offer a “solar with gel top coat” service.

No. Solar nails cure through air oxidation — a chemical reaction between the liquid monomer and powder polymer that hardens without any UV or LED lamp. This is one of the key distinctions between solar nails and gel nails. Gel nails (both bio gel and UV gel) require UV or LED lamp curing. Solar nails are sometimes called “solar gel nails” colloquially, but they are an acrylic product and require no lamp equipment.
Solar gel nails are an acrylic system that air-cures and lasts 3–5 weeks with excellent UV resistance and chip resistance. UV gel nails require a UV or LED lamp to cure, have a lighter and more flexible feel, offer hundreds of color options, and typically last 2–3 weeks. Solar nails are stronger but heavier; UV gel nails are lighter but less durable. Solar nails are UV-resistant and won’t yellow outdoors; UV gel can discolor under prolonged sun exposure.
Solar nails generally last longer than bio gel. Solar nails typically wear for 3–5 weeks before a fill is needed. Bio gel lasts 3–4 weeks. The difference is due to solar nails’ rigid acrylic structure, which is more impact-resistant and less prone to lifting than bio gel’s flexible polymer formula. However, with proper care and regular fills, both systems can be maintained for months before full removal is required.
Solar nails are a type of acrylic nail, but not all acrylics are solar nails. The term “solar nails” refers specifically to CND’s UV-stabilized acrylic formula that resists yellowing under sunlight and maintains a high-gloss finish without a top coat. Standard acrylic nails can yellow within weeks of UV exposure. Solar nails use superior UV-protective agents that standard acrylic formulas do not contain. Both are acrylic systems requiring no UV lamp to cure.
Bio gel is generally considered better for natural nail health than solar nails. Bio gel requires minimal surface prep, no harsh primers, and its breathable formula allows some oxygen exchange with the natural nail. It is also easier to remove with less acetone exposure. Solar nails require more surface filing during application and a longer acetone soak for removal. However, when applied and removed correctly by a trained technician, both systems are safe for regular use with appropriate nail rest between sets.
In the USA, a full set of solar nails costs $45–$70, bio gel costs $50–$80, and UV gel costs $35–$65. In Canada, solar nails run CA$55–$85, bio gel CA$60–$95, and UV gel CA$45–$75. Over a full year, solar nails and bio gel may cost less in total than UV gel despite higher per-visit prices, because they require fewer appointments annually (13 vs 18–26 visits).
